Output 323477e86eefd99f741d2b93f667a251e609db46c3e32cb7f875306ad4a1f02d:0

value
4345900
script pubkey
OP_0 OP_PUSHBYTES_20 c18c0a873d4db150dd9661b03fdb937bc6bbdec5
address
bc1qcxxq4peafkc4phvkvxcrlkun00rthhk9zudn9l
transaction
323477e86eefd99f741d2b93f667a251e609db46c3e32cb7f875306ad4a1f02d